
East Carolina Softball Releases Fall Schedule
September 17, 2015 | Softball
GREENVILLE, N.C. - The East Carolina softball team will be back in action for the fall season it was announced by head coach Courtney Oliver Thursday. The Pirates will host three fall games at ECU Softball Stadium, while playing three on the road.
ECU opens the fall season Saturday, Sept. 26 at Walnut Creek Park in Raleigh, N.C. against North Carolina at 10 a.m., followed by a 12:30 p.m. match up with UNC Greensboro.
The Pirates host UNC Pembroke Sunday, Sept. 27, at 10 a.m. at ECU Softball Stadium before taking on Longwood at 2 p.m. UNC Pembroke and Longwood will play each other at noon between the Pirates' games.
The final home fall game will be played Saturday, Oct. 24 at noon at ECU Softball Stadium. East Carolina will host Pitt Community College in the contest.
The Pirates will wrap up the fall season Sunday, Oct. 25 in Elon, N.C., with a noon doubleheader against the Phoenix at Hunt Softball Park.
East Carolina is coming off of a season in which it finished 16-37 overall and 7-11 in American Athletic Conference action. The Pirates return 15 student-athletes from a year ago, led by First Team All-American Conference senior shortstop Casey Alcorn. Additionally, ECU has added four new names to the roster with a quartet of incoming freshman. At the helm of the ECU Softball program is first-year head coach Courtney Oliver
